Why? The purpose of these sessions are to train researchers to leverage the Genomics England clinical and genomic data, to assist them in their analysis.

Who? These sessions will be accessible to all users eligible to access the Research Environment / Genomics England dataset - including both Discovery Forum and Research Network members.

When? We arrange training sessions on a monthly basis. Please see the schedule below.

What? You can find material from previous training sessions and bioinformatics clinics in the links on the left. What comes next depends on you, so don't hesitate to reach out to us with suggestions on what to cover in upcoming sessions.

Where? All training sessions will be held online via Zoom and recordings of the session will be made available afterwards with all sensitive data removed.
